如果您是從事海外 Web3/加密項目的自由職業者、IT 開發人員、營銷人員或設計師,您很可能通過您的個人錢包收到 USDT 或 USDC 付款。
你是否曾經想過(或聽別人說過):“越南法律對加密貨幣沒有規定,所以我不需要繳稅”?
這種想法並不罕見。但更重要的問題是:法律是否也這樣看待你的資金流動?
本文並非意在嚇唬您或教您如何逃稅。其唯一目的是幫助您瞭解作為自由職業者,收到USDT並將款項存入您的越南銀行賬戶時所涉及的真正法律風險。
1️⃣ 問題不在於加密貨幣,而在於收入。
圍繞“加密貨幣是否有自己的法律?”這個問題,爭論不休。但實際上,稅法無需等待加密貨幣法律出臺才能生效。稅法並不關心你如何獲得資金,它只關注資金流動的性質。
具體來說,稅務機關會考慮以下三個因素:
- 你是否有收入來源?
- 該收入是否來源於提供服務/勞動?
- 您能否解釋一下您的資金來源?
如果您參與海外項目,提供服務(例如編碼、營銷、設計、運營、諮詢等),並按小時、按里程碑或定期收取報酬,那麼這本質上就是您的職業收入。即使客戶不在越南,即使付款以 USDT/USDC 進行,即使項目在越南沒有法律實體,加密貨幣也僅僅是一種支付工具,並不會自動使收入“免稅”。
2️⃣ “誰在管理鏈上資金?”——這沒錯,但這並不是全部真相。
一個非常常見的反駁論點是: “錢在鏈上錢包裡;政府無法控制它。”
這種說法只對了一部分。實際上,風險並非產生於錢還在錢包裡的時候,而是產生於錢進入傳統金融體系的那一刻。
一個非常常見的例子:你將USDT兌換成越南盾。資金會通過交易所、P2P平臺或中間網關進入你的越南銀行賬戶。此時,資金流動就需要被記錄下來。
銀行有義務:監控異常交易,記錄資金流動,並在當局要求時提供信息。
稅務機關無需瞭解區塊鏈。他們只需要問一個非常簡單的問題: “這筆錢從哪裡來?屬於哪種類型的收入?是否已申報?”
3️⃣ 最危險的誤解:“還沒有人受傷。”
許多自由職業者表示:“我從事這一行很多年了,一直都沒遇到過任何問題。”
法律風險並非一朝一夕形成。它們通常在以下情況下出現:收入隨時間逐漸增長;現金流充裕且穩定;出現審計、檢查或要求解釋的情況。
那麼,問題就不再是“你繳稅了嗎?”,而是變成了:
- 你有任何文件可以佐證你的解釋嗎?
- 是否有合同?
- 有職位描述嗎?
- 收入是否已記錄?
否則,你將完全處於被動地位。
4️⃣ 法律如何看待來自 Web3 的自由職業收入?
從法律角度來看,Web3自由職業者的收入本質上與以下情況並無不同:
- 自由職業者獲得美元報酬。
- 為外國公司遠程工作的自由職業者。
- 自由職業者提供跨境服務。
最大的區別在於:
- 使用加密貨幣支付
- 而且很多人從一開始就沒有規範他們的文書工作。
Web3自由職業者需要明白一個非常重要的點:加密貨幣並非像許多人認為的那樣處於法律灰色地帶。真正的灰色地帶在於收入記錄缺乏規範化。
如果沒有服務合同、適當的工作文件和合理的現金流說明,風險可能不會立即出現,但一旦出現,就很難處理。
5️⃣ 這是否意味著 Web3 自由職業者是“錯誤的”?
不一定。絕大多數自由職業者並非故意逃稅。許多人只是身處一個全新的領域,缺乏正規的指導,只能依靠行業經驗。
問題的關鍵不在於意圖,而在於遇到情況時的準備程度。法律不以口頭陳述為準,而只依據:收入、現金流和解釋能力。
6️⃣ 那麼,Web3自由職業者現在應該瞭解什麼呢?
本文並未針對每個人提供具體建議,因為每個人的收入水平、收款方式和法律情況都不同。
但有一條普遍原則:不要等到別人問你才開始尋找解釋。
至少要規範三件事: - 工作文件:合同/協議、工作描述、電子郵件/Slack 記錄,證明你的工作內容 - 收入記錄:月度日誌、簡易發票、報表 - 現金流邏輯:USDT 從哪裡來 → 如何兌換 → 如何到達銀行。
規範合同、現金流和收入確認方法總是比事後處理後果更容易、更便宜、更安全。
結論
此時,你會發現“加密貨幣法律是否已經出臺?”這個問題並非重點。重點在於收入、現金流以及在必要時提供問責的能力。
由於我收到很多 Web3 自由職業者的提問,Followin 組織了一場名為“越南區塊鏈:法律視角與職業發展機遇”的研討會。在本次研討會上,Followin 將幫助您瞭解:
✅ 什麼是加密貨幣?區分虛擬資產和支付方式。
✅ 法律“灰色地帶”:越南國家銀行禁止什麼,又有哪些行為尚未禁止?
✅ Ooki DAO 案例研究:當 DAO 遇到麻煩時,誰應承擔法律責任?附贈:接收 USDT 時如何規範現金流 + 降低風險的注意事項。
👉 立即點擊此鏈接註冊: https://forms.gle/4dWUz7mJAUdCuKAT8如有任何疑問,請在下方留言或加入 Followin Telegram 群組 https://t.me/Followinweb3 獲取專屬幫助!






